Summary: We consider Poisson's equation in an \(n\)-dimensional exterior domain \(G\) \((n \geq 2)\) with a sufficiently smooth boundary. We prove that for external forces and boundary values given in certain \(L^q(G)\)-spaces there exists a solution in the homogeneous Sobolev space \(S^{2,q}(G)\), containing functions being local in \(L^q(G)\) and having second-order derivatives in \(L^q(G)\) Concerning the uniqueness of this solution we prove that the corresponding nullspace has the dimension \(n+1\), independent of \(q\).
